On fractional difference logistic maps: Dynamic analysis and synchronous control
Nonlinear Dynamics ( IF 5.2 ) Pub Date : 2020-09-11 , DOI: 10.1007/s11071-020-05927-6
Yupin Wang , Shutang Liu , Hui Li

This paper investigates a logistic map derived from a difference equation in the framework of discrete fractional calculus. Through the Poincaré plots and Julia sets, the map’s chaotic and fractal characteristics are studied comparing with those of a quadratic map to be proposed. The memory effect of fractional difference maps is reflected in these dynamics, and some reasonable explanations are given by combining with quantitative analysis. A coupled controller is designed to realize synchronization between fractional difference logistic map and fractional difference quadratic map.
